History of Linux
Developed by “Linus Torvalds” a
student of “University of Helsinki” in
“1991”
Torvalds put Linux Source Code on
Internet.
Developers showed interest and Linux
started to grow.
Still thousands of developers are
programming Linux and Software for
Linux using Internet.

Why the name Linux?
Linux was made as a free and Open
Source version of Unix.
And it was developed by Linus
Torvalds
So
Linus + Unix = Linux
Linux is pronounced many ways, and
all of them are correct.

Linux Supported Platforms
Linux can run every where from Hand
Held devices to Super Computers
Some of Nokia N-Series Mobiles use
a Compact Version of Linux.
Most of the Supper Computers today
run Linux Operating System.

Uses of Linux
Linux is Used mostly as a Web Server
Operating System , due to it’s stability
and reliablity.
“Google” runs Linux on it’s more than
ten thousand Web Servers.
Now a days with the help of
Commercial Packages such a
RedHat’s Fedora Core 8 Linux can be
used for desktop computers.
